Roesing Ape, AKA Christopher Roesing, is a Cincinnati Based, Northern Kentucky native, artist and promoter. Holding degrees in French and Theatre from Northern Kentucky University and A Masters in Arts Administration and an MBA from the University of Cincinnati's college Conservator of music and the college of Business, he has been highly active in the Cincinnati arts scene for a decade. Roesing Ape has released four experimental music albums on local labels and has been included in several musical compilations in other cities across the country. He is also a published novelist, and has been creating video for local dancers and performers for four years, with Choreographers without companies and performance and Time Arts Series, Media Bridges' Autumedia and Tha Blast Urban Arts and Cultural Festival. He has performed in over 15 cities nationally and abroad in Germany, and regularly creates performance art and musical show for Cincinnati events. Roesing Ape is also the founder of Art Damage, Inc; a small non-profit dedicated to bringing experimental and noise arts to Cincinnati Audiences. His day job as Direct* of Development & External Relations for Madcap Puppet Theatre brings him great joy.
